This episode we hear Shappi Khorsandi's word for indispensable mates, Ahir Shah turning German, and Alexei Sayle's word for when you're not quite as good at martial arts as you think you are. Ever struggled to find the right word for a feeling or sensation? Unspeakable sees comedian Phil Wang and lexicographer Susie Dent invite celebrity guests to invent new linguistic creations, to solve those all too relatable moments when we're lost for words.
